Investigation in the case of mass murders committed against Polish citizens (including soldiers of the Polish Army and the Home Army) in the years 1941-1945 in Ponary near Vilnius by the officials of the Hitler’s police and the co-operating Lithuanian police

An extensive research in the Lithuanian archives allowed to find out documentation which turned out to be interesting also in the context of other investigations. The documentation will make the reconstruction of the names of the people murdered in Ponary possible. The archival materials in German include codified information concerning the selection of victims who were later executed. Breaking of the code was possible due to the co-operation with the Zentralle Stellung in Ludwigsburg. The aim of the investigation is to reconstruct unknown facts and circumstances of the crimes committed against Poles. The accumulated evidence constitutes 30 volumes of records. October 3rd, 2002
